  • Top 5 Workouts for Reducing Love Handles and Back Fat

    When it comes to targeting love handles and back fat, incorporating specific workouts into your routine can make a significant difference. These exercises not only help tone the muscles in these areas but also promote overall fat loss. Here are the top five workouts that can help you achieve a leaner waistline and a more sculpted back.

    1. Side Planks

    Side planks are an excellent exercise for engaging the obliques and improving core stability. To perform a side plank, lie on your side, propping yourself up on one elbow while keeping your body in a straight line. Hold this position for 30 seconds on each side, gradually increasing the duration as you get stronger. This workout not only targets love handles but also strengthens your back muscles.

    2. Russian Twists

    Russian twists are a dynamic exercise that effectively engages the entire core, particularly the obliques. To do this exercise, sit on the ground with your knees bent and lean back slightly. Hold a weight or a medicine ball, and twist your torso to one side, then the other. Aim for 3 sets of 15-20 twists per side. This movement helps burn calories while toning the waist and improving rotational strength.

    3. Bicycle Crunches

    Bicycle crunches are a powerful workout for both your abs and obliques. Lie on your back, lift your legs to a tabletop position, and alternate bringing your elbows to your opposite knees while straightening the other leg. Perform 3 sets of 15-20 repetitions. This exercise not only targets love handles but also engages the entire core, promoting fat loss and muscle definition.

    4. Mountain Climbers

    Mountain climbers are a high-intensity exercise that boosts your heart rate while effectively targeting your core. Start in a plank position and quickly drive your knees toward your chest, alternating legs. Aim for 30 seconds to 1 minute, completing 3-4 sets. This full-body workout engages your back and helps reduce fat around the waist, making it a great choice for anyone looking to slim down.

    5. Deadlifts

    Deadlifts are a compound movement that not only targets the lower back but also engages the glutes and hamstrings. To perform a deadlift, stand with your feet hip-width apart, hinge at your hips, and lower a barbell or dumbbells toward the ground while keeping your back straight. Focus on proper form and gradually increase the weight. Incorporating deadlifts into your routine can help build strength and reduce back fat effectively.

    The Role of Nutrition in Combating Back Fat and Love Handles

    Maintaining a healthy diet is crucial in the battle against back fat and love handles. Nutrition plays a pivotal role in determining body composition and fat distribution. When aiming to reduce these stubborn areas, it is essential to focus on nutrient-dense foods that promote fat loss and overall well-being. Incorporating a balanced diet rich in whole foods can significantly impact your journey toward a slimmer waistline and a toned back.

    Key Nutritional Components to Consider:

    • Lean Proteins: Foods such as chicken, turkey, fish, legumes, and tofu can help build muscle while aiding in fat loss. Protein is essential for repairing tissues and can keep you feeling full longer.
    • Healthy Fats: Incorporating sources of healthy fats, like avocados, nuts, and olive oil, can help regulate hormones and improve metabolism, making it easier to shed excess fat.
    • Fiber-Rich Foods: Whole grains, fruits, and vegetables provide fiber that promotes digestive health and keeps you satiated, reducing the likelihood of overeating.
    • Hydration: Staying adequately hydrated can improve metabolic processes and help reduce water retention, which can sometimes contribute to the appearance of love handles.

    Another crucial aspect of nutrition is managing calorie intake. Consuming fewer calories than you expend is fundamental for fat loss. However, itโ€™s not just about cutting calories; the quality of those calories matters. Focusing on whole, unprocessed foods rather than sugary snacks and refined carbohydrates can lead to better results in targeting back fat and love handles. Additionally, incorporating a variety of colorful fruits and vegetables can provide antioxidants and essential vitamins that support overall health and fat loss.

    Lastly, meal timing and frequency can also play a role in managing body fat. Some studies suggest that eating smaller, more frequent meals can help regulate blood sugar levels and control hunger, which may prevent overeating. Pairing these meals with regular physical activity will enhance the effects of good nutrition and contribute to a more toned physique. By understanding the role of nutrition, you can create a sustainable plan that targets back fat and love handles effectively.

    How to Incorporate Cardio and Strength Training for Back Fat Reduction

    To effectively reduce back fat, a combination of cardio and strength training is essential. This dual approach not only helps burn calories but also builds lean muscle, which can enhance your overall body composition. Start by incorporating at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ity cardio into your weekly routine. Activities such as brisk walking, cycling, or swimming are excellent options. Aim for sessions that last 30 minutes, five days a week, to maximize fat loss while keeping your workouts manageable.

    In addition to cardio, integrating strength training exercises specifically targeting the back muscles can further enhance your results. Focus on compound movements that engage multiple muscle groups. Effective exercises include:

    • Deadlifts: This exercise targets the entire back, promoting muscle growth and strength.
    • Pull-ups or Lat Pulldowns: Great for building upper back strength and improving posture.
    • Rows: Both bent-over and seated rows help in toning the middle back.
    • Reverse Flys: Target the upper back and shoulders, contributing to a more sculpted appearance.

    To achieve optimal results, consider scheduling your strength training sessions two to three times a week. Allow at least 48 hours of recovery between workouts for the same muscle group to prevent overtraining. Combining these workouts with cardio not only accelerates fat loss but also enhances your overall fitness level. For best results, alternate between cardio and strength training days, ensuring that you maintain a balanced routine that promotes fat loss while building muscle.

    Moreover, incorporating high-intensity interval training (HIIT) into your cardio sessions can significantly boost calorie burn. HIIT workouts typically involve short bursts of intense exercise followed by brief rest periods, which can be particularly effective in targeting stubborn back fat. Pair these workouts with your strength training regimen, and youโ€™ll create a comprehensive plan that supports fat reduction and muscle definition in your back area.
